Transaction d4ee713130a76db2bc6989076d3025691798f291513c121eae654f854dc38965
1 Input
1 Output
-
d4ee713130a76db2bc6989076d3025691798f291513c121eae654f854dc38965:0
- value
- 890249
- script pubkey
- OP_0 OP_PUSHBYTES_20 7077a471f8a84a37002d585686d14421eafc1896
- address
- bc1qwpm6gu0c4p9rwqpdtptgd52yy840cxykutmmjn